               HON'BLE MR. JUSTICE ARUN MONGA

Order 20/01/2025

1. At the very outset, learned counsel for the petitioner submits that qua the grievance by the petitioner in the petition, he is sanguine that, in case his case is taken up on administrative side, it will receive favorable treatment. Therefore, the petitioner may be granted liberty to file a representation before the competent authority and the competent authority may be directed to decide (Downloaded on 21/01/2025 at 09:49:05 PM) [2025:RJ-JD:3476] (2 of 2) [CW-21440/2024] the same in light of Circular dated 03.11.2010 (Annex.3), as expeditiously as possible.

2. Without commenting on the merits of case, in view of the submission made, the competent authority of respondents is directed to decide the representation to be filed by the petitioner objectively in light of Circular dated 03.10.2010 (Annex.3), as expeditiously as possible by passing appropriate speaking order in accordance with law.

3. It is made clear that the direction to consider the representation shall not be construed as an expression of any opinion, in any manner.

4. Disposed of accordingly.

5. Pending application(s), if any, also stand(s) disposed of.
